Apparently, the slow-down at the factory
is due to the intricacies of the PS5's revolutionary
system-on-chip.
The sources claim that production yield for
Sony's SOC chips has dropped as low as 50%,
meaning 1 in 2 is deemed not good enough.

As it stands, Microsoft is leading the race for Christmas
sales, having announced that the Xbox Series X
will cost £449 ($499, AU$749) and the Series S £249 ($299, AU$499).
Xbox pre-orders begin from 22nd September.]
